What Is the Cost of Living Near Provo?

Understanding the cost of living near Provo is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Fillmore Elementary School.
Provo's Cost of Living Index is approximately 97.8 (2.2% less expensive than US average; 3.6% less than UT average). Home to BYU, 'Silicon Slopes' area, housing near US avg. UTA bus/FrontRunner. When planning your budget based on a salary from Fillmore Elementary School,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,000 - $1,500+ A significant portion of Fillmore Elementary School sal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$100 - $180 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$85 (UT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$390 - $570 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$680+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,295 - $3,585+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
